- Inspired by nature -- Conditions for magma vesiculation -- Mechanism of bubble formation -- Growth and expansion of bubbles -- Temporal development of vesiculation -- Other bubble-related processes -- Cooling crystallization of magma -- Crystallization induced by vesiculation -- CSD (Crystal Size Distribution) -- Application -- Appendix.
This book comprehensively illustrates the elemental processes of vesiculation and crystallization recorded in volcanic products on the basis of the equilibrium and non-equilibrium theories. The book describes the derivation of equations and the basic physics behind them in detail. This textbook is fundamental in preparing for future volcanic hazards. The target readers are graduate students and researchers, but Parts I and IV are written to be understandable by undergraduate students as well, to inspire them to enter this field.
